Study Programs and Their Pathways

1. Business & Management

Bachelor’s Options: BBA (Business Administration), BBM (Business Management), BBS (Business Studies)

Master’s Options: MBA (Business Administration), MBS (Business Studies), EMBA (Executive MBA)

Future Careers: Corporate leadership, Finance & Banking, Marketing, HR, Consulting, Entrepreneurship

For students who love leadership, strategy, and building businesses.

2. Hospitality & Tourism

Bachelor’s Options: BHM (Hotel Management), BTTM (Travel & Tourism Management), Culinary Arts Programs

Master’s Options: MHM (Hotel Management), Master’s in Tourism & Hospitality, MBA (Hospitality Management)

Future Careers: Hotel & Resort Management, Event & Conference Leadership, Travel Consultancy, Airline & Cruise Hospitality, Food & Beverage Entrepreneurship

For students who enjoy creativity, global exposure, and people-centered careers.

3. Information Technology & Computing

Bachelor’s Options: BIT (Information Technology), BSc CSIT (Computer Science & IT), BCA (Computer Applications)

Master’s Options: MIT (Information Technology), MSc (Data Science, AI, Cybersecurity), MCA (Computer Applications)

Future Careers: Software Development, Cybersecurity, AI & Data Analytics, Cloud Computing, Tech Startups, IT Project Leadership

For students passionate about coding, problem-solving, and driving digital innovation.

How to Choose the Right Path

Self-Discovery: Identify your strengths — leadership, creativity, or technology.

Explore Study Options: Learn what each program offers (Bachelor’s & Master’s).

Match with Career Goals: Does the program align with industries you want to join?

Think Long-Term: Bachelor’s gives you entry; Master’s helps you specialize and lead.

Seek Mentorship: Talk to seniors, professionals, and counselors before making a final choice.
